.colour-chart .container-fluid{overflow-x:visible }.colour-chart #morphsearch{margin-top:0 }.colour-chart #morphsearch .search-form__input{font-style:normal }.colour-chart #morphsearch .morphsearch-submit{background:transparent;width:auto;padding:0 }.colour-chart #morphsearch .search-form__btn{opacity:0 }.colour-chart .project-buttons{display:none }.colour-chart .search-form__wrapper{float:right;position:relative }.colour-chart .search-form{margin-top:65px }.colour-chart .search-form__input{float:left;width:380px;height:77px;background-color:#fafaf8;border:none;border-radius:0px;padding:20px;box-shadow:none;font-style:italic;font-weight:300 }.colour-chart .search-form__input::-webkit-input-placeholder{color:#4a4a4a }.colour-chart .search-form__input:-moz-placeholder{color:#4a4a4a }.colour-chart .search-form__input::-moz-placeholder{color:#4a4a4a }.colour-chart .search-form__input:-ms-input-placeholder{color:#4a4a4a }.colour-chart .search-form__btn{float:right;background:transparent;padding:0;border:0px;font-size:50px;margin-left:-77px;z-index:2;position:absolute;top:4px;right:5px;font-size:38px;color:#4a4a4a;-webkit-transform:none;-ms-transform:none;transform:none;opacity:1 }.colour-chart .search-form__btn i{font-size:45px;color:#292B22 }.colour-chart .search-form--text{display:none }.colour-chart .btn{white-space:normal }.colour-chart .navbar{padding-left:0px }.colour-chart .page-header{margin-top:0px }.colour-chart #colour-types{position:relative;margin:30px auto 70px auto;float:none }.colour-chart #colour-types li{background:#FAFAF8;margin-right:5px;position:static;z-index:10 }.colour-chart #colour-types li.active{background:#fff;border:1px solid #292B22;border-bottom:none;margin-top:-29px;position:static;border-bottom:1px solid #fff }.colour-chart #colour-types li.active .level-2{display:block }.colour-chart #colour-types li.active a{padding:39px 94px;background:#fff;border-bottom:1px solid #fff;z-index:12 }.colour-chart #colour-types li.active ul li a{border-bottom:none;}.colour-chart #colour-types li a{padding:25px 94px }.colour-chart #colour-types li a .menu--link-text{float:left;width:100%;font-size:20px;text-align:center;line-height:24px;letter-spacing:0.8px;text-transform:uppercase;font-weight:normal;color:#4a4a4a }.colour-chart #colour-types li a .menu--link-text p{font-size:14px;margin-bottom:0px;text-transform:none;font-weight:300 }.colour-chart #colour-types li:hover ul.level-2{z-index:10 }.colour-chart .mini-colour-types .btn-group a:first-child{border-left:none }.colour-chart .mini-colour-types .btn-group a:last-child{border-right:none }.colour-chart #colour-types .level-2{position:absolute;top:100px;width:100%;text-align:center;padding-left:0;list-style:none;background:#fff;padding-bottom:0;z-index:5 }.colour-chart #colour-types .level-2 .navbar--list-item{display:inline-block;list-style-type:none;width:auto;background:#fff;margin:0;padding:0;margin-top:8px }.colour-chart #colour-types .level-2 .navbar--list-item.active{border:0 }.colour-chart #colour-types .level-2 .navbar--list-item.active .menu--link{font-weight:700;padding:24px 20px;background:#F3F3ED }.colour-chart #colour-types .level-2 .navbar--list-item:hover .menu--link{background:#F3F3ED }.colour-chart #colour-types .level-2 .navbar--list-item .menu--link{text-align:center;display:block;height:43px;padding:10px 20px !important;background:#fff;font-size:18px;font-weight:300;-webkit-transition:all linear 0.2s;transition:all linear 0.2s }.colour-chart #colour-types .level-2 .navbar--list-item .menu--link .menu--link-text{font-weight:300;font-size:14px }.colour-chart .colour-block__title,.colour-chart .colour-block__code{display:none }.colour-chart .colour-block:hover__title{display:none }.colour-chart .colour-block:hover__code{display:none }.colour-chart .colour-block__outer{float:left;width:33.333333333%;padding:10px 5px 0 }.colour-chart .colour-block__outer:nth-child(3n) .project-buttons{right:auto;left:10px }.colour-chart .colour-block--large{height:calc(100vw / 3 * 1.25) }.colour-chart .load-more{margin-top:40px }.colour-chart .btn-block{letter-spacing:0.8px }.colour-chart .btn-block:hover{background:#292B22;color:#fff }@media (min-width:1050px) and (max-width:1289px){.colour-chart #colour-types li a{padding:25px 60px }.colour-chart #colour-types li.active a{padding:39px 64px }}@media (max-width:1049px){.colour-chart .page-header{margin-bottom:0 }.colour-chart .search-form{margin-top:0;margin-bottom:17px }.colour-chart .search-form__wrapper{float:none;display:block;overflow:hidden }.colour-chart .search-form__input{width:100%;border:1px solid #E9E9E4;background:#fff;color:#4a4a4a;font-size:16px;font-weight:500;font-style:normal;text-transform:uppercase }.colour-chart .colour-chart-subnav{margin:19px 0;padding:0 10px;border:none }.colour-chart .colour-chart-subnav__selector{padding:10px 15px;position:relative;border:1px solid #292B22;text-align:left }.colour-chart .colour-chart-subnav__selector .active{margin-left:10px }.colour-chart .colour-chart-subnav__selector i{position:absolute;top:50%;right:15px;-webkit-transform:translateY(-50%);-ms-transform:translateY(-50%);transform:translateY(-50%);font-size:36px }.colour-chart .colour-chart-subnav__list{height:auto;border:1px solid #292B22;border-top:none }.colour-chart .colour-chart-subnav .navbar--list-item{display:block;width:100% }.colour-chart .colour-chart-subnav .navbar--list-item a{float:none;display:block;padding:10px 15px;background:#fff;color:#292B22;font-size:16px }.colour-chart .colour-chart-subnav .navbar--list-item a:hover,.colour-chart .colour-chart-subnav .navbar--list-item a:focus,.colour-chart .colour-chart-subnav .navbar--list-item .active a{background-color:#292B22;color:#fff }.colour-chart #colour-types .level-2 .navbar--list-item .menu--link .menu--link-text{font-size:16px }}@media (min-width:830px){.colour-chart .btn{white-space:nowrap }.colour-chart .colour-block__outer{position:relative;width:25% }.colour-chart .colour-block__outer .colour-block--large{height:calc(100vw / 4 * 1.25) }.colour-chart .colour-block__outer:nth-child(4n) .project-buttons{right:auto;left:15px }.colour-chart .colour-block__outer:nth-child(3n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er .project-buttons{z-index:1000;position:absolute;bottom:1px;right:15px }}@media (min-width:1050px){.colour-chart .colour-block__outer{width:20% }.colour-chart .colour-block__outer .colour-block--large{height:calc(100vw / 5 * 1.25);-webkit-transition:all 0.2s linear;transition:all 0.2s linear;-webkit-transform:scale(1);-ms-transform:scale(1);transform:scale(1) }.colour-chart .colour-block__outer:nth-child(5n) .project-buttons{right:auto;left:15px }.colour-chart .colour-block__outer:nth-child(4n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er:nth-child(3n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er:nth-child(3n+1):hover .colour-block__title,.colour-chart .colour-block__outer:nth-child(3n+1):hover .colour-block__code{left:9px }.colour-chart .colour-block__outer:nth-child(5n+1):hover .colour-block__title,.colour-chart .colour-block__outer:nth-child(5n+1):hover .colour-block__code{left:14px }.colour-chart .colour-block__outer:hover .colour-block--large{-webkit-transform:scale(1.02);-ms-transform:scale(1.02);transform:scale(1.02) }.colour-chart .colour-block__outer:hover .colour-block--large .colour-block__title,.colour-chart .colour-block__outer:hover .colour-block--large .colour-block__code{display:block;visibility:visible;font-size:11px }.colour-chart .colour-block__outer:hover .project-buttons{display:block }.colour-chart .navbar{position:static }.colour-chart #colour-types{position:static;width:1000px }.colour-chart #colour-types .navbar--list-item{position:static }.colour-chart #colour-types .level-2{border-top:1px solid #292B22;top:129px }}@media (min-width:1290px){.colour-chart .colour-block__outer{width:14.285714286% }.colour-chart .colour-block__outer .colour-block--large{height:calc(100vw / 7 * 1.25) }.colour-chart .colour-block__outer:nth-child(5n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er:nth-child(4n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er:nth-child(3n) .project-buttons{right:15px;left:auto }.colour-chart .colour-block__outer:nth-child(7n) .project-buttons{right:auto;left:15px }.colour-chart .colour-block__outer:nth-child(5n+1):hover .colour-block__title,.colour-chart .colour-block__outer:nth-child(5n+1):hover .colour-block__code{left:9px }.colour-chart .colour-block__outer:nth-child(7n+1):hover .colour-block__title,.colour-chart .colour-block__outer:nth-child(7n+1):hover .colour-block__code{left:14px }.colour-chart #colour-types .level-2 .navbar--list-item .menu--link .menu--link-text{font-size:18px }.colour-chart #colour-types{width:1180px }}
.project-buttons{position:absolute;width:35px;height:35px;bottom:-3px;right:8px;cursor:pointer;}.project-buttons .list-inline{margin-left:0;}.project-buttons.left .project-buttons__subactions{left:-11px;}.project-buttons.left .project-buttons__subactions:after{left:9px;}.project-buttons.right .project-buttons__subactions{left:-190px;}.project-buttons.right .project-buttons__subactions:after{left:189px;}.project-buttons__item{position:absolute;top:0;left:5px;}.project-buttons__subactions{display:none !important;position:absolute;top:35px;left:-101px;background:white;padding:10px 0 0;width:225px;background:#eff0eb;z-index:100;}.project-buttons__subactions a{color:#292b22;text-decoration:none;display:block;}.project-buttons__subactions:after{content:"";display:block;width:0;height:0;position:absolute;top:-15px;left:100px;border-left:15px solid transparent;border-right:15px solid transparent;border-bottom:15px solid #eff0eb;}.project-buttons .project-buttons__subactions.list-inline.compare:after{border-left:15px solid transparent;border-right:15px solid transparent;border-bottom:15px solid #4a4a4a;}.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item{text-transform:uppercase;}.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item a{color:#fff;}@media (min-width:830px){.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item:hover a{color:#fff;}}.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item:last-of-type{text-transform:lowercase;margin-bottom:10px;}.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item:last-of-type a{color:#292b22;}@media (min-width:830px){.project-buttons .project-buttons__subactions.list-inline.tint .project-buttons__subactions-item:last-of-type:hover a{color:#292b22;}}.project-buttons__subactions-item{width:calc(100% - 30px);display:block;text-align:center;font-size:12px;background:#fff;padding:10px 0px;margin:4px 15px;}.project-buttons__subactions-item{-webkit-transition:background 0.2s linear;transition:background 0.2s linear;}.project-buttons__subactions-item a{-webkit-transition:color 0.2s linear;transition:color 0.2s linear;color:#292b22;}@media (min-width:830px){.project-buttons__subactions-item:hover{background:#292b22;}.project-buttons__subactions-item:hover a{color:#fff;}}.project-buttons__subactions-heading{width:calc(100% - 30px);display:block;text-align:center;font-size:12px;background:transparent;padding:10px 0px;margin:4px 15px 4px;text-transform:uppercase;}.project-buttons__subactions-heading i{color:#292b22;}.project-buttons__subactions-heading.compare{padding:9px 0;margin:2px 0 0;width:100%;background:#4a4a4a;}.project-buttons__subactions-heading.compare a{color:#fff;}.project-buttons__subactions-heading.compare i{color:#fff;margin-right:3px;}.project-buttons__link:hover + .project-buttons__subactions{display:block;}.project-buttons .plus{display:inline-block;position:relative;width:16px;height:16px;}.project-buttons .plus .bar{display:block;width:1px;height:100%;position:absolute;left:8px;}.project-buttons .plus .bar:first-child{-webkit-transform:rotate(-90deg);-ms-transform:rotate(-90deg);transform:rotate(-90deg);}.project-buttons__item--light > a{color:#fff !important;}.project-buttons__item--light .bar{background:#fff !important;}.project-buttons__item--dark > a{color:#292b22 !important;}.project-buttons__item--dark .bar{background:#292b22 !important;}.project-buttons.clicked .project-buttons__subactions{display:block !important;}
